Welcome to my blog. I am a legal academic and have, over the years, held posts at the Universities of Leeds and Bradford, Leeds Beckett University and Birmingham City University. Currently I am the Head of Law at Leeds Trinity University. My research interests are varied but all in some way linked to legal education, questions of identity, academic careers and mobility or equality or in some cases all of them. So expect posts of that nature with a good measure of randomness included.

I have, over the course of my career so far, taught all sorts of stuff from English Legal System to EU Law to Legal Skills to Employment Law and more quirky options like Law and Society. As I progressed in my career I have spent less time in the class room but I really don’t think I would ever want a post where I would have to stop teaching completely. It’s my sanity check, my link to why I do what I do and a place where I probably learn more than I teach.

My varied research interests have seen me study highly skilled mobility within the EU, the Court of Justice of the EU and the European Court of Human Rights, gender equality in promotions in the HE sector, internationalisation of legal education and the nature of good teaching. I have also written about my experiences of becoming a law lecturer as well as my experiences in middle management as well as about legal pedagogy, legal education reform and a bunch of other stuff

I have held various roles externally.  I was the Chair of the Association of Law Teachers a few years ago and have been on the Committee for a very long time. I am treasurer (for the second time) as of April 2024. I have also been the Deputy Editor of the Law Teacher: The International Journal of Legal Education and then General Editor with my term ending with Issue 2 of 2024 when I move into a Consultant Editor role. I am also the Co-Convenor for the Society of Legal Scholars Legal Education Subject Section and sit on their Legal Education sub-committee.
